No From in new email
 
When I click on an email address in an email (to Reply, etc) the compose box opens and I have to sel ect the From account and then subject, etc.

However I'm unable to send although it has a valid From address and the only way it will send is if I go to Options in the compose box and sel ect an account.

I noticed that although there is a From, the account name is not listed in the status bar of the compose but does show up when I select the Fr om account fr om Options.

Bug or by design?
 
Highlight the account you want to open emails. Then open Properties / general and about 3/4 of the way down you will see a check box to make it the default for mailto: addresses

Normally, when I compose an email the From has my email address and down in the status bar of the compose window it shows the account name. As and example, if I compose an email and sel ect larry@tbat.com (made up email address) in the From area at the bottom the name "TheBat" would show. If I want to change the From I can also sel ect a new address from the status bar by left clicking and selecting one of my accounts.

If I click on an email address shown in an email, say notwork@tbat.com the compose window opens with no Fr om default email address and nothing showing in the status bar. If is change the Fr om to larry@tbat.com there is still no status bar account shown.  In this situation I can't send the email. There are workarounds but it seems strange that a compose will open that won't actually send the email.
